How much do logistic oper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for logistic operations manager in New Mexico is $65,939.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$51,400.00 and $78,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a logistic operations manager do?

A Logistic Operations Manager oversees the daily operations related to the movement and storage of goods within a company. Their responsibilities include coordinating transportation, managing inventory, ensuring efficient supply chain processes, and supervising logistics staff. They also work to optimize costs, maintain compliance with regulations, and ensure timely delivery of products to customers or retailers. By streamlining logistics processes, they help businesses operate more efficiently and meet customer demands eff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a logistic operations manager?

To thrive as a Logistic Operations Manager, you need expertise in supply chain management, inventory control, and logistics planning, typically supported by a degree in logistics, business, or related fields. Proficiency with logistics software (such as SAP or Oracle), warehouse management systems, and often certifications like APICS or Lean Six Sigma are highly valued.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help you effectively manage teams and coordinate with vendors and clients. These competencies are crucial for ensuring efficient operations, timely deliveries, and cost-effective logistics solutions.

What are some common challenges faced by logistic operations managers when coordinating cross-functional teams?

Logistic Operations Managers often coordinate with procurement, warehouse, transportation, and customer service teams, which can lead to challenges in communication and alignment of priorities. Balancing the needs of each department while ensuring smooth, timely deliveries requires strong organizational and negotiation skills. Additionally, adapting quickly to unexpected disruptions—such as supply shortages or shipping delays—demands effective problem-solving and the ability to motivate teams under pressure. Building strong relationships and maintaining transparent communication are key to overcoming these challenges.

Job overview:

Schneider is seeking a Warehouse Operations Manager in Carlsbad to lead a warehouse or terminal. The Warehouse Operations Manager will coach warehouse associates while overseeing warehouse metrics related to safety, quality, productivity, cost control and customer service.

Responsibilities:

  • Lead, coach and develop a team of warehouse associates and leaders.
  • Adhere to budgets and review financial results.
  • Develop strategies around staffing and schedules to align with volume and demand.
  • Hold associates and leaders accountable for achieving business metrics and goals.
  • Provide guidance on the warehouse's daily activities, including loading/unloading freight, doing maintenance, checking inventory, etc.
  • Collaborate with internal and external customers to resolve issues and implement improvement opportunities.
  • Organize regular staff meetings to ensure proper communication.

Skills and q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in business, logistics, supply chain or a related field.
  • 4-6 years of previous logistics, supply chain or warehouse experience.
  • Knowledge of warehouse and yard management systems.
  • Experience using Microsoft Office applications.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Excellent leadership skills.
  • Valid driver's license and meet Schneider's DMV record standards.
